Market context

Polymarket is pricing the Los Angeles International Airport maximum for 22 July 2026 as a very narrow outcome: **76-77°F** is trading around 93%, with **78-79°F** the only meaningful alternative at about 7%[1]. For a user holding USDC on Polygon, that means the conditional tokens are effectively saying the day’s peak at KLAX is expected to land just below 78°F, not far enough for a broader summer heat spike to matter unless the airport station prints a clear upside surprise[1].

That pricing fits a market that is being read through the lens of airport microclimate, not downtown Los Angeles heat headlines. LAX temperatures are often moderated by marine influence, so traders should treat the market as a station-specific measurement rather than a citywide feel; on the day itself, the relevant number is the single highest reading reported by the Wunderground KLAX history page, which resolves the contract[1]. Recent local weather coverage also pointed to a regional heat advisory pattern in Southern California around 22 July, which can raise daytime maxima even when coastal sites remain comparatively restrained[3].

For traders, the main catalysts are the intraday temperature path at KLAX, any marine-layer clearing, and the timing of the afternoon peak before the settlement window closes at 12:00 UTC. Current conditions across Los Angeles have been warm and sunny, with AccuWeather showing 83°F and a much higher RealFeel, but that does not translate directly to the airport reading used for settlement[2]. In practice, the market will move most if forecast updates or observed coastal warming suggest KLAX can break out of the high-70s rather than stay in its usual narrow band[1][2].

Resolution & payout

At resolution the UMA oracle takes over: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, any token holder can dispute within two hours. Without dispute the result is accepted and the smart contract distributes USDC instantly.

On Kalshi (CFTC-regulated) resolution runs through their in-house clearing engine in USD. Betfair Exchange settles after match end in the account's local currency. Manifold pays no cash — only its in-platform "mana" currency.

What's the difference between YES and NO shares?
A YES share pays $1.00 if the event happens, $0 otherwise. A NO share pays $1.00 if the event doesn't happen. The market price between 0¢ and 100¢ is the implied probability.
